  • What are the psychological impacts of residing in a former meth lab?

    Residing in a property previously used as a meth lab can cause psychological distress due to concerns about residual contamination, health risks, and social stigma. This stress can lead to anxiety, depression, and a diminished sense of well-being. Full disclosure and thorough remediation can help alleviate some of these concerns.

  • What should I do if meth contamination is found in my property?

    If meth contamination is detected, its important to hire certified remediation professionals to clean and decontaminate the property. Attempting to clean the property yourself can be dangerous and may not effectively remove all contaminants.

  • Who should consider hiring meth lab testing services?

    Individuals purchasing or renting a property with a suspected history of meth production or use should consider hiring meth lab testing services. Property owners, real estate agents, and landlords may also utilize these services to ensure their properties are free from contamination and to protect the health of future occupants.
